How To Start a Business with Less or No Money?

Evaluate Yourself

Since you have nothing to lose, the first step is to ask yourself the following questions.

  • Where do your passions and skills lie?
  • What sets you apart from everyone else?
  • Find out how much your existing connections can aid in developing and realizing your business plan.
  • Consider how best to use your financial means if they are available. (you must have money aside from your business to feed your family for at least 6 to 12 months).

Uncovering the answers to the questions above gives you a clear road map of what you want and how to attain it.

Look for Alternative Financing Sources

There are alternative funding options to consider, even though starting a business with little to no capital requires relying on your resources. Think about crowdfunding websites where you can showcase your business concept to a large audience and attract investors. Or you can even grab a business loan in case you have a great idea to pitch.

Moreover, ask your friends and relatives for assistance and hunt for angel investors (those who give money in exchange for shares in your company).

Start a Service-based Business

Money is needed for some, but not all, businesses. If you have a talent, you can launch a service-based company with no money down. Some ideas are presented below.

  • Babysitting: If you love infants and are adept at handling them carefully.
  • Pet sitting: If you’re good with animals and can put them at ease, consider offering pet sitting.
  • Freelance writing: Consider freelancing if you have a way with words and want to make a living with it.
  • Social media marketer, copywriter, or email marketer: If you know how to manage advertising campaigns and bring conversions through words.
  • Handyman services: If you are good at repairing and fixing.
  • Less Specialized Services: You can give housekeeping, supervision, dog walking, and vehicle washing services.
  • Online tutoring: If you have a grip on a particular subject.

Get your Idea Validated with Preorders

Preorders are a powerful way to test market demand and generate revenue. You can test customer interest and business viability by pre-selling your products or services. Preorders boost your finances and give you confidence as an entrepreneur.
